563,444,687,332,384 is an even composite number composed of six pr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 563444687332384 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 6 prime factors (large circles) and 972 divisors.

563444687332384 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of nine hundred seventy-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 563444687332384:

25 × 112 × 132 × 232 × 1092 × 137

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 13 × 23 × 23 × 109 × 109 × 137)
